What companies run services between Hyatt Regency London – The Churchill, England and DoubleTree by Hilton London Victoria, England?

Metroline Travel operates a bus from Marble Arch to Victoria Bus Station every 15 minutes.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 12 min. Go Ahead London also services this route every 15 minutes. Alternatively, London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Oxford Circus station to Victoria station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£2–3 and the journey takes 3 min.
